Comparable Facts

Compare Northwest Missouri State University in Maryville, MO with Rockhurst University in Kansas City, MO on tuition, admissions, graduation, earnings, and student body data using the table above.

Northwest Missouri State University is larger than Rockhurst based on total student enrollment (9,152 students vs. 3,577 students)

Location, institution type, and student-faculty ratio

  • Northwest Missouri State University is located in Maryville, MO (Remote Town setting); Rockhurst University is in Kansas City, MO (Large City setting).
  • Northwest Missouri State University is a public, non-profit 4-year institution. Rockhurst University is a private, non-profit 4-year institution.
  • Student-to-faculty ratio: Northwest Missouri State University 16:1; Rockhurst University 12:1.

Northwest vs. Rockhurst Cost Comparison

Which college is more expensive, Northwest or Rockhurst? Published tuition is the sticker price; many students pay less after aid (see average net price below).

  • The typical actual cost that students pay to attend (average net price) is less at Northwest Missouri State University than Rockhurst ($16,790 vs. $25,787).
  • Living costs (room and board or off-campus housing budget) at Rockhurst University are 2.9% lower than at Northwest Missouri State University ($11,920 vs. $12,282).
  • Rockhurst University is 323.8% more expensive for in-state tuition than Northwest (about $34,355 more per year; $44,966.00 vs. $10,611.00).
  • Out-of-state tuition is 159.6% higher at Rockhurst than at Northwest Missouri State University (about $27,642 more per year; $44,966.00 vs. $17,324.00).
  • A larger share of students receive grant aid at Rockhurst University than at Northwest Missouri State University (100% vs. 95%).
  • The average total grant financial aid received by Rockhurst University students is 279.8% larger than aid received by Northwest Missouri State University students ($34,562 vs. $9,101).

Northwest vs. Rockhurst Admissions comparison

Which college is harder to get into, Northwest or Rockhurst? Typical SAT and ACT scores (same estimates as in the table above), middle 50% test ranges where reported, test score submission policy, deadlines, and acceptance rates summarize admission difficulty between Rockhurst and Northwest.

  • The typical SAT score (median estimate) at Rockhurst University (1180) is 100 points higher than at Northwest (1080).
  • Incoming Rockhurst students have a 3 point higher typical ACT composite (median estimate) (24 vs. 21 at Northwest).
  • Reported middle 50% SAT composite range (25th-75th percentile) for admitted students: Northwest Missouri State University 976/1193; Rockhurst University 1116/1246.
  • Reported middle 50% ACT composite range (25th-75th percentile) for admitted students: Northwest Missouri State University 19/24; Rockhurst University 22/27.
  • Submitting SAT or ACT scores: Northwest - Test optional; Rockhurst - Test optional.
  • Typical fall application deadline: Rockhurst Jun 30, 2027.
  • Accepted freshman Rockhurst students have a 0.17 point higher average high school GPA (3.62) than students at Northwest (3.45).
  • Northwest has a higher acceptance rate (86.1%) than Rockhurst (69.6%).
  • The share of admitted students who enrolled (yield) is 22.2% at Northwest vs. 19.2% at Rockhurst.

Northwest vs. Rockhurst Graduation Outcomes Comparison

How do outcomes compare for Northwest and Rockhurst? Graduation rate, earnings, and student loan debt are common indicators. The bullets below summarize the same federal outcomes fields as the comparison table (College Scorecard / IPEDS where applicable).

  • Rockhurst University's six-year graduation rate (74%) is higher than Northwest Missouri State University's (49%).
  • Graduates from Rockhurst University earn a median of about $12,300 more per year than Northwest graduates about ten years after starting college ($53,500 vs. $41,200), per the same Scorecard earnings definition.
  • Among federal student loan borrowers, Rockhurst University graduates have a $4,500 lower median loan debt than Northwest graduates ($20,500 vs. $25,000).
  • Among borrowers, Rockhurst graduates have an estimated $47 lower median monthly federal student loan payment than Northwest graduates ($211 vs. $258).
  • More Rockhurst graduates are actively paying back their federal student loan debt than former Northwest students, three years after graduation. (74% vs. 63%)

Sources: U.S. Department of Education https://nces.ed.gov IPEDS and College Scorecard https://collegescorecard.ed.gov/. Values reflect the most recent year available in our dataset.
